Kenny warns FG to be ready for 2009 general election

FINE GAEL leader Enda Kenny has followed his Labour counterpart and warned his party members to be ready for a general election next year.

Last month, Labour leader Eamon Gilmore said he was putting his party on an election footing because of the possibility of the Government falling over the budget.

Mr Kenny has now followed suit, telling the annual Fine Gael presidential dinner in Dublin over the weekend that there was a “very real prospect” of a general election in 2009. He also said he expected to be Taoiseach after the election.
